he shall stand - that is, persevere: implying the endurance of His kingdom [Calvin]. Rather, His sedulous care and pastoral circumspection, as a shepherd stands erect to survey and guard His flock on every side (Isa 61:5) [Maurer].

feed - that is, rule: as the Greek word similarly in Mat 2:6, Margin, means both “feed” and “rule” (Isa 40:11; Isa 49:10; Eze 34:23; compare 2Sa 5:2; 2Sa 7:8).

in the majesty of the name of the Lord - possessing the majesty of all Jehovah’s revealed attributes (“name”) (Isa 11:2; Phi 2:6, Phi 2:9; Heb 2:7-9).

his God - God is “His God” in a oneness of relation distinct from the sense in which God is our God (Joh 20:17).

they shall abide - the Israelites (“they,” namely, the returning remnant and the “children of Israel previously in Canaan) shall dwell in permanent security and prosperity (Mic 4:4; Isa 14:30).

unto the ends of the earth - (Mic 4:1; Psa 72:8; Zec 9:10).
